Backend Engineer

👋 We’re looking for a backend engineer to join us in building Amondo, an audience engagement platform for global brands including the Olympics, New Balance and Live Nation.

(We’re also looking for a frontend engineer – see our other job post!)

The Role

We’re looking for an experienced backend engineer to support our ambitious development roadmap.

As part of a small, dynamic engineering team of five, you’ll play a key role in building a platform used by some of the world’s most iconic companies, including Fortune 500 brands. You’ll collaborate closely with the founder, product team, and designers to develop innovative backend features, refine infrastructure, and ensure our platform meets the highest standards of scalability and reliability.

This is an exciting opportunity to join a fast-growing, innovative startup at a pivotal stage of its journey.

What we value

The ideal developer for Amondo is someone who is a self-starter, understands the product deeply, is confident engaging with stakeholders, can plan their work and communicates proactively with the team.

Autonomy: The ability to work independently, make informed decisions and manage time effectively.

Communication: Strong communication skills are essential at every level. Developers should communicate clearly and concisely with team members, customers and other stakeholders, keeping everyone informed of progress, challenges and solutions.

Technical competency: Possesses strong technical skills to efficiently tackle complex problems, execute tasks efficiently and deliver high-quality results.

What you’ll do

  • Design and develop new platform features, including a GraphQL API for internal dashboards, user-facing APIs, media transformation pipelines and server infrastructure.
  • Optimise and enhance development processes and workflows to boost efficiency and team productivity.
  • Implement robust monitoring and analytics tools to improve the observability, reliability and performance of our services.
  • Ensure smooth transitions between platform iterations, maintaining backward compatibility and seamless user experiences.
  • Conduct R&D on GPT-powered features and traditional “smart” algorithms to drive innovation and expand platform capabilities.

The tech

  • Node.js, NestJS, Cucumber.js, GraphQL, PostgreSQL, Turborepo, pnpm
  • Docker, Sentry, Grafana, GitHub Actions
  • AWS, S3, Render, Heroku, PostHog
  • GitHub, Slack, Notion, Linear
  • Frontend: React, Remix, Tailwind, Vite, Jest, Cypress, Storybook, Radix, Chromatic

About you

  • Strong, demonstrable working experience with PostgreSQL and GraphQL
  • Confident working with AWS and Heroku
  • TDD, Git and CI development experience
  • Awareness of best DevOps practices
  • Experience working in a lean startup environment
  • Enjoy using modern collaboration tools – Linear, Notion, GitHub
  • Not afraid to work with frontend part of the product
  • Bonus: Experience working with third-party APIs including Instagram, Twitter/X Facebook, YouTube and Spotify
  • Bonus: Experience with Cloudinary, SendGrid, RabbitMQ, Infosec, S3+CloudFront

What we offer

  • Interesting and challenging work
  • Work remotely, no commuting to the office
  • 4 day work week
  • 5 weeks of paid vacation
  • Flexible work hours
  • Employee autonomy
  • Annual international team retreats
  • Other perks in the pipeline

Equal opportunities

We value diversity and believe success comes from teams where everyone can be their authentic selves. We welcome applicants from underrepresented backgrounds and are committed to an inclusive, non-discriminatory environment for all.

The application process

  1. Submit your application via the form (with an optional video submission)
  2. A call with the founder to discuss the company, mission and team
  3. A call with one/some of our engineering team to discuss stack and processes
  4. A paid trial project – which will give both sides a hands-on opportunity to get to know each other

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*